Sourcing guidance for Aac Aluminium Powder
What are the key technical specifications to consider when sourcing AAC Aluminium Powder?
When purchasing for Autoclaved Aerated Concrete (AAC) production, the most critical factor is the active aluminum content, which should ideally be above 90%. You must also specify the particle size distribution (fineness), as this directly affects the gas evolution rate and the pore structure of the concrete. Common grades include 600-mesh or 800-mesh powders. Additionally, verify the gas evolution speed (usually measured at 2, 4, 16, and 30 minutes) to ensure it matches your slurry's setting time to prevent hydrogen leakage or structural collapse.
How does the form of the aluminum (powder vs. paste) affect procurement and usage?
While Aluminium Powder is highly effective, it is classified as a flammable solid and poses a significant dust explosion risk. Many modern AAC plants prefer Aluminium Paste because it is pre-wetted with water or diethylene glycol, making it safer to handle, easier to disperse in the mixer, and less strictly regulated during transport. However, if you choose powder, ensure your facility has explosion-proof equipment and strict humidity control in the storage area.
What compliance standards and quality certifications are required for international trade?
Suppliers should provide a Material Safety Data Sheet (MSDS) and a Certificate of Analysis (COA) for every batch. For AAC applications, look for compliance with GB/T 2085.2 (Chinese standard for aluminum powder for AAC) or equivalent international standards like ASTM. Since it is a hazardous material, the supplier must have a Dangerous Goods (DG) export license and provide a UN38.3 test report or a Classification Report for Transport of Goods to ensure legal cross-border movement.
What is the economic feasibility of sourcing AAC Aluminium Powder in bulk?
To optimize costs, B2B buyers should aim for Full Container Load (FCL) shipments, as the fixed costs for hazardous goods handling are high. Prices are highly sensitive to the London Metal Exchange (LME) aluminum spot price. It is recommended to sign long-term supply contracts with price adjustment formulas to hedge against raw material volatility. Cross-Border Procurement & Risk Management for AAC Aluminium Powder
What are the primary risks associated with shipping AAC Aluminium Powder internationally?
The primary risk is moisture contamination, which can trigger a chemical reaction releasing hydrogen gas, leading to container pressure buildup or fire. Ensure the supplier uses vacuum-sealed plastic liners inside steel drums or reinforced fiber drums. Always verify that the shipping line accepts Class 4.1 (Flammable Solids) or Class 4.3 (Substances which in contact with water emit flammable gases), as many standard carriers refuse these materials.

What are the specific storage and handling precautions for the buyer upon arrival?
Upon receipt, the powder must be stored in a cool, dry, and well-ventilated warehouse away from heat sources, sparks, and acidic or alkaline materials. Strictly prohibit smoking and the use of non-explosion-proof tools in the storage area. Ensure your local staff are trained in Class D fire extinguisher usage, as water should never be used to extinguish aluminum fires.
How can I align my purchase with international trade policies and customs requirements?
Check the Harmonized System (HS) Code (typically 7603.10 for powders of non-lamellar structure) to determine the exact import duties in your country. Be aware of Anti-Dumping Duties (ADD) that some regions (like the EU or USA) may impose on Chinese aluminum products. Ensure the supplier provides a GHS-compliant label in the language of the destination country to avoid customs clearance delays.
